年龄对肾脏效率的影响。

Effects of age on renal efficiency.

作者信息

Pathak J D, Joshi S V

出版信息

Indian J Physiol Pharmacol. 1982 Apr-Jun;26(2):125-9.

PMID:7141617
Abstract

Renal efficiency of 70 healthy subjects, 20 young av. age 27.2 +/- 5.8 yrs and 60 elderly av. age 68.2 +/- 4.7 yrs was studied by simple water elimination test in the monitoring under standard conditions. After drinking 2 litre of water, hourly samples of urine upto 4 hrs were collected for volume, sp. gr. urea, creatinine etc. The younger group passed 77% of the extra water drunk in 2 hrs and 92.5% in 4 hrs, whereas the elderly could throw out only 33% in 2 hrs and 56% in 4 hrs. The elderly showed much delayed and poorer elimination. The sp. gr., urea and creatinine in each sample of urine were less in the old indicating their inefficient elimination ability. Av. blood urea was 20.2 +/- 3.8 mg+ in young and 25.4 +/- 7.0 mg% in elderly, respectively. Calculated av. urea clearance value was 61.3 ml/mt in the young, while it was 39.4 ml/mt in the elderly. How well this simple test reflects the decreasing renal efficiency on ageing and compares with more elaborate tests like urea clearance is discussed.

摘要

在标准条件监测下,通过简单的排水试验研究了70名健康受试者的肾脏效率,其中20名年轻人平均年龄为27.2±5.8岁,60名老年人平均年龄为68.2±4.7岁。饮用2升水后,每小时收集尿液样本,持续4小时,检测尿量、比重、尿素、肌酐等指标。年轻组在2小时内排出了摄入额外水分的77%,4小时内排出了92.5%,而老年人在2小时内仅排出33%,4小时内排出56%。老年人的排泄明显延迟且较差。老年人尿液样本中的比重、尿素和肌酐含量较低,表明其排泄能力低下。年轻人的平均血尿素为20.2±3.8毫克%,老年人为25.4±7.0毫克%。计算得出年轻人的平均尿素清除率为61.3毫升/分钟,而老年人为39.4毫升/分钟。本文讨论了这项简单测试如何很好地反映衰老过程中肾脏效率的下降,以及与尿素清除率等更复杂测试的比较情况。
